License Number Verification
By the way, you can cross-check the licence number on the official GC portal. Plug it in, and if the system spits out “valid”, you’re good. If it returns “not found”, you’ve just dodged a bullet.
Payment Methods: The Litmus Test
Fast-forward to the deposit page. Does it offer trusted options like PayPal, Visa, or bank transfer? If you see obscure e-wallets only, that’s a warning. Reputable sites lock down financial fraud with tried-and-true partners.
Customer Support: The Real Barometer
And here is why: a legitimate bookmaker will have live chat, a phone line, and a responsive email. Test it. Send a quick query. If you get an automated reply that doesn’t address your question, you’re probably dealing with a ghost.
Security Protocols
Encryption isn’t optional. Look for “https” and a padlock icon. If the site still runs on plain HTTP, you might as well hand over your wallet to a pickpocket. SSL certificates are a baseline, not a bonus.

Actionable Checklist
1. Locate the licence number.
2. Verify it on the GC website.
3. Assess payment options.
4. Test customer support responsiveness.
5. Confirm SSL encryption.
6. Scan community reviews.
